Akhu Poem by Edward Kofi Louis

Akhu



Nicely,
Quite lovely!
And like the muse of your lover called Akhu;
But, do you know that,
To whom you yield yourselves as servants to obey,
His of her servants you are to whom you obey? !
And like the rules of various laws on this earth,
But, it was quite lovely to see you once again.
